Also, if you haven't dealt with them before, check the powerstat wiring
carefully, and look for shorts to the core/frame. I had one go a couple years
ago, and, fortunately, it was on a GFCI. Also, check the configuration (0-120V,
0-140V, or something less common) to avoid unfortunate incidents. That looks
like a 3A unit. Did I guess right?
